March 27 (Reuters) - French videogame maker Ubisoft UBIP.PA said on Thursday it has set up a subsidiary for its Assassin’s Creed, Far Cry, and Tom Clancy’s Rainbow Six brands.
China's Tencent 0700.HK will invest 1.16 billion euros ($1.25 billion) for a 25% stake in the new subsidiary, valued at about 4 billion euros, the group said in a statement.
